Katsina spends N97m monthly on water distribution

The Katsina state government spends over N97 million monthly for the procurement of 127, 000 liters of diesel to sustain water supply across the state.

Acting Permanent Secretary, state Ministry of Water Resources, Alhaji Rabo Danmusa disclosed this Wednesday while fielding questions from newsmen at his office in Katsina.

He explained that the diesel was being supplied to the 10 water works across the state, which include Malumfashi, Funtua, Dutsinma, Zobe Regional Water Works, and Kofar Kaura Booster station in Katsina.

Others are Sabke, Daura, Dutsi, Mashi and Jibia Water Works, which pump water to the various distribution networks in these towns and their environs.
